A damp spot on the floor or a drain that keeps backing up usually means the pipe problem is already past the warning stage. In Murray Hill FL, older cast iron systems can crack, scale inside, and start leaking where you cannot see it. That is when small plumbing issues turn into damage under floors, in walls, or around the foundation.


Homeowners usually call after repeated clogs, rust-colored water near drains, sewer smells, or a repair that stops working again. If the system is failing in more than one place, patching one section at a time often delays the real fix. A proper replacement plan gives you a cleaner path forward and helps reduce the risk of hidden damage.


This is also where the right diagnosis matters. A camera inspection, drain evaluation, and a close look at the visible piping help determine whether you need a targeted section replacement or a larger cast iron changeout. That kind of judgment saves time, prevents guesswork, and helps you avoid paying for work that will not hold up. How does replacing cast iron compare with patching the same line again?

Replacement is usually the better choice when the pipe has repeated failures, internal corrosion, or multiple weak spots. A patch may buy time, but it does not solve widespread deterioration. An on-site evaluation shows whether a repair is still practical or whether replacement will be the more reliable fix.

What should I do before the plumber arrives?

Clear access to the affected area if you can, and note any backups, odors, or leaks you have noticed. If water is actively entering the home, shut off the affected fixture or the main supply if needed. Having that information ready helps the visit move faster and keeps the diagnosis focused.
